Output 7b5e3142c772fe17db3c5099960c66a19de20d81808a1534796861a34585a151:1

value
31307743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a85cb1074729cdd7ff12bb8e9ae84d9c0bfe2c4f OP_EQUAL
address
MPFNnydePvJnTfF4XEb1WoycZWMHTqK2EG
transaction
7b5e3142c772fe17db3c5099960c66a19de20d81808a1534796861a34585a151
spent
true